How to choose the right platform
Choosing the right online learning platform can significantly impact a student’s educational experience. There are several factors to consider to ensure you make the best choice for K-12 education.
Assess your needs
First, determine what features are important for your learning style. Each platform offers unique tools that cater to different preferences. Consider whether you need:
- Interactive lessons with multimedia content
- Access to a variety of subjects and courses
- Customizable learning paths for individual students
Next, think about the level of student support you require. Platforms with 24/7 access to tutors or community forums can enhance the learning experience. It’s essential to explore the user interface as well. A simple and intuitive design will help students focus on learning rather than navigating complex menus.
Consider the cost
Another critical factor is the cost of the platform. Some platforms offer free access with limited features, while others charge a subscription fee. Balancing affordability with necessary features is important. Make a list of the platforms that interest you and compare their pricing structures.
In addition, check if there are any free trials available. Many platforms provide trial periods that allow you to explore their features before committing. This way, you can evaluate how well the platform suits your educational needs.
Look for reviews and recommendations
Reading reviews and seeking recommendations can be very helpful. Check for feedback from other parents and students to uncover their experiences. Similar performance concerns may be highlighted, which can aid in making your decision. Access to customer service is also important. A good platform should have responsive support to assist with any issues that may arise.
Once you gather this information, it can be easier to narrow down your options. With the right research, selecting a suitable online learning platform can lead to a positive learning outcome for students.
Engagement strategies for K-12 students
Engaging K-12 students in online learning can be challenging but is essential for their academic success. There are several strategies that educators and parents can use to keep students motivated and focused.
Incorporate interactive elements
One effective strategy is to incorporate interactive elements into lessons. Platforms that use quizzes, polls, and interactive videos foster a more dynamic learning environment. These engaging tools make learning fun and help retain students’ attention. For example, consider:
- Using gamified assessments to enhance motivation
- Implementing virtual field trips to connect lessons to real-world experiences
- Creating collaborative projects using online tools
When students can actively participate, they tend to engage more deeply with the content.
Utilize multimedia resources
Another way to capture students’ interest is by using multimedia resources. Videos, infographics, and audio clips can break up text-heavy lessons. This variety caters to different learning styles and keeps students engaged. Research shows that using different formats can improve comprehension and retention.
Integrating storytelling into lessons can also resonate with students. Narratives evoke emotions, making the material more relatable. Additionally, providing opportunities for students to share their stories can foster a sense of community in the virtual classroom.
Promote social interaction
Encouraging social interaction among students is vital. Setting up group discussions, peer reviews, or group projects can help students bond. When students work together, they learn from each other, which enhances both their social skills and academic performance.
Moreover, consider using discussion boards or chat features on the platform. These tools allow students to ask questions and share ideas outside of live sessions. Regular check-ins and feedback can further build relationships and maintain engagement.
Future trends in online education
Future trends in online education are evolving rapidly, shaped by technology and changing learner needs. These trends promise to enhance the learning experience for K-12 students.
Personalized learning experiences
One of the most significant trends is personalized learning. Using data analytics and artificial intelligence, education platforms can tailor lessons to suit individual students. This approach allows students to learn at their own pace, focusing on their strengths and improving their weaknesses. As a result, students are more likely to stay engaged and perform better academically.
- Adaptive learning systems that adjust difficulty based on performance
- Customized learning paths that align with student interests
- Real-time feedback to guide improvement
Personalization not only supports academic growth but also fosters a love for learning.
Increased use of virtual reality (VR)
Another exciting trend is the integration of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) in online education. These technologies create immersive learning environments where students can explore new concepts firsthand. Imagine a biology lesson where students can virtually walk through the human body or a history class that takes them back in time to ancient civilizations.
Such experiences enhance understanding and retention of complex topics. Furthermore, these interactive environments often make learning more enjoyable, which can lead to increased motivation among students.
Focus on social and emotional learning
As education continues to adapt to modern challenges, there is a growing emphasis on social and emotional learning (SEL). Understanding emotions, building relationships, and developing empathy are essential skills for success in and out of the classroom. Online platforms are beginning to incorporate SEL into their curricula.
This focus helps students improve their decision-making skills and emotional intelligence, equipping them for future challenges. Many programs now offer videos, discussions, and collaborative activities that promote SEL, ensuring students become well-rounded individuals.
